Handover note for release week. The Plumfern thumbnail generation queue is stable but has two quirks worth knowing. First, oversized PNGs (>40MB) get routed to the slow lane and can take 15 minutes; this is expected, not a stall. Second, the dead-letter queue must be drained manually before each release cut — the script is drain_dlq.sh in the tools repo. Metrics dashboards are under "Plumfern/Thumbs." If anything blocks the release, contact the engineer named below.

account owner for bawip-tahag: Raleth Quenok

### Action Item 7: Enforce dependency pinning

Following the Bramblewick outage, all services must pin transitive dependencies via the lockfile generated by Pindrop CI. Unpinned builds will fail the `supply-check` gate starting next sprint. On-call engineers should treat lockfile drift alerts as page-worthy until the rollout stabilizes, since a silent version bump caused the original regression. The enforcement thresholds and grace windows we agreed on are recorded here.

tuning constants:
QUOTAS = {
    "druwyn": 5,
    "holix": 5,
    "zorath": 5,
    "holwyn": 10,
}

Team, ahead of this week's sync: responsibility for cache invalidation in the Marrowline product catalog is moving out of the platform group. The stale-price incidents last month showed we need a single accountable owner for the invalidation rules, TTL policy, and the purge-on-update hooks. Documentation has been consolidated into the Catalog Reliability space, and the runbook now includes a dry-run mode. Effective Monday, all invalidation changes require review by the person named below.

account owner for bawip-fajeg: Ralix Oliwyn

Re: Retirement of the Stonebriar product line

Stonebriar sales have declined for five consecutive quarters and support costs now exceed contribution margin. The retirement plan is staged: new orders close end of Q2, existing contracts honoured through their terms, and spares stocked for twenty-four months. Sales leads should steer prospects toward the Ashgrove range; migration incentives are already approved. Customer comms are drafted and awaiting legal sign-off. The forward strategy behind this decision is set out in the note below.

confidential, yafog-hagug: Gross margin on Druix came in at 10 percent against a plan of 15 percent. Only 5 of the 80 pilot accounts renewed Druix, so a churn review is set for October 1.